Code 2: Distinct visual change in enamel visible when wet, lesion must be visible when dry.\n\nCode 3: Localized enamel breakdown because of caries with no visible dentin or underlying shadow.\n\nCode 4: Underlying dark shadow from dentin with or without localized enamel breakdown.\n\nCode 5: Distinct cavity with visible dentin. Code 6: Extensive distinct cavity with visible dentin.\n\nAfter treatment, the evaluation will be performed as follows: Increase to ICDAS 3 or more indicates caries progression; decrease to 0-1 this indicates caries regression. If score remains the same this indicates no change in lesion.\n\nNo. of lesions with scores 0,1,2,3 or more will be assessed and analyzed.'}, {'measure': 'Activity of a carious lesion using Nyvad Caries Diagnostic Criteria', 'timeFrame': '12 months (Baseline, 1 month, 3 months, 6 months and 12 months)', 'description': 'Code 0: Sound (normal) enamel Code 1: Active caries (intact surface) - Surface of enamel is whitish/yellowish opaque Code 2: Active caries (surface discontinuity) Code 3: Active caries (cavity) - Enamel/dentin cavity easily visible with the naked eye.\n\nCode 4: Inactive caries (intact surface) - Surface of enamel is whitish, brownish or black.\n\nCode 5: Inactive caries (surface discontinuity) - Same criteria as score 4. Proving their positive effect would be the basis for the development of innovative dental materials and hygienic agents to combat the carious process, which is a critical prerequisite for improving the quality of dental services and reducing dental anxiety and fear.', 'detailedDescription': "Dental caries is a major public health concern, especially in very young children. Early detection of the disease enhances and simplifies treatment effectiveness. Non-operative treatments are particularly advantageous as they are minimally invasive, reduce future operative treatment needs and are more comfortable, thereby improving overall compliance and dental experience.\n\nThe aim of the study is to compare the clinical efficacy of Silver diamine fluoride (SDF) and laboratory prepared green synthesized Nano-silver fluoride on early enamel lesions in primary teeth.\n\nThe proposed study is a randomized controlled clinical trial. Included patients are healthy positive children aged from 3 to 8 years, requiring non-operative treatment of incipient caries lesions on smooth surfaces of primary teeth. Lesions will be assessed visually using ICDAS II, Nyvad criteria and laser fluorescence (LF pen).\n\nPatients are randomly assigned to one of three study groups:\n\nGroup N: Green synthesized Nano silver fluoride (prepared in laboratory) Group S: SDF + KI (38% Riva Star, SDI) Group C: Control group\n\nPrior to treatment parents are informed about the nature of the study and sign an informed consent. Children are introduced to the method of conducting treatment in a style appropriate for the child's age. Lesions are assesed using the ICDAS II system, Nyvad criteria and laser fluorescence. All patients receive professional oral hygiene with a fluoride-free brush and polishing paste. Treatment of each patient's respective teeth is performed following the treatment protocol of the respective agents. Follow-ups are performed at 1st, 3rd, 6th and 12th month."}, 'eligibilityModule': {'sex': 'ALL', 'stdAges': ['CHILD'], 'maximumAge': '8 Years', 'minimumAge': '3 Years', 'healthyVolunteers': True, 'eligibilityCriteria': "Inclusion Criteria:\n\n* Age: 3 - 8 years\n* Signed informed consent from parents to participate in the study.
